First, let’s talk about the importance of IG analytics. This is a feature that Instagram offers that allows you to find information about your followers, content, and stories. These insights offer surface-level analytics through: Impressions, Reach, and Engagement. By checking and tracking this information you will learn how to interpret and implement the data towards a strategy to grow your business. 


There are 4 awesome tools you can use to leverage Instagram analytics and grow your following! Step 1, is figuring out when to post. To do this, you will want to determine when your followers are most active. Everyone’s audience is different! So check yours to know when to post and at what time for the future! Using this information, set a schedule, and plan out your instagram posts. Try using one of our favorite planning apps “Later” or “Plannoly”. Those come highly recommended. From us. Be sure to track the success of each post and time and adjust your schedule accordingly. 

Step 2, appeal to your target audience. Again, figuring out who your target audience is, is so important! Instagram analytics can help you figure out who your current audience is made up of. Age, location, gender, interests, etc. Adjust your content to cater to your target audience!

Step 3, understand the type of content your audience engages with. As this step ties into step 2 closely. We are again referring to what your audience/consumer wants to see more of! For example, if you get more post engagement when you upload a photo of you, as opposed to not a lot of post interaction from a funny meme post…. You now know what your audience wants to see more of. YOU! So check out the interactions and reach features to determine this.

Finally, step 4, analyze your call-to-action. If you own a small business and all of your revenue comes from “sales or purchases”, you may want your CTA to be “click the link in our bio” to learn more. But if you want your CTA to direct people to your Instagram profile to grow your following base because you are an influencer, then your call-to-action should be asking people to check out your profile! Make sense? I hope so! Another fun call-to-action is to have people tag their besties, or comment in the captions. You will be able to decide from your analytics if you should use these special call-to-actions or not.
